ShiftMed and NAHCA Join Forces to Bring One-Stop Solution to Workforce Crisis

ShiftMed, one of the largest workforce management platforms in health care with over 60,000 credentialed health care professionals, and the National Association of Health Care Assistants (NAHCA), the professional association for Certified Nursing Assistants (CNAs), have joined forces to launch the National Institute for CNA Excellence (NICE). NICE is an integrated training platform that includes a learning management system to recruit, train, certify, and retain CNAs. The solution will be immediately available to skilled nursing facilities. 

With CNA workforce shortages at record levels, and the need for long-term care among older adults on the rise, accessibility to quality education and training are national imperatives. As a virtual platform, NICE is designed to address this crisis by providing both CNAs and skilled nursing providers with recruitment, certification, job placement, continuing education, and ongoing career support all in one place. ShiftMed's network of over 1,500 enterprise health care partners will also help solve the workforce shortage by providing the required on-site, hands-on experience required for certification.

Through NICE, CNAs will have access to highly qualified instructors, including post-acute and long-term care physicians, aging services policy leaders, and luminaries on topics that include Alzheimer's disease, person-centered care, infection prevention and control, palliative care, survey and certification, and relevant federal regulations.

For its part, ShiftMed will tap its database of health care professionals to provide a purpose-driven career pathway for uncertified personal care aides through NICE. Once prospective CNAs have completed their online education through NICE, they will download the ShiftMed mobile app and be matched with nearby health care employers.

Initial launch of the partnership will take place in Texas, a state that has been heavily impacted by the Delta and Omicron variants. Senior Living Properties, LLC, a 50-location provider across the state of Texas, has signed on as the initial launch partner of NICE.

HireQuotient Unveils EasySource - The ChatGPT-powered Future of Talent Sourcing

PRnewswire | May 03, 2023

HireQuotient, the next-generation HR Tech organization, has launched EasySource - the world's first fully automated talent sourcing product with embedded ChatGPT. With EasySource, recruiters can create curated talent pipelines and engage candidates effectively with minimal human intervention to reduce time-to-hire drastically. This free product is geared for sourcing and engaging relevant candidates for sales & marketing roles in the US. EasySource utilizes cutting-edge technology to identify the most relevant job seekers from active and passive talent pools based on their skills, interests, relevant experience and US work authorization. To engage qualified candidates, the product hyper-personalizes communication across email and LinkedIn using embedded ChatGPT and automates multi-channel outreach using workflows optimized for generating maximum response. Recruiters can reach out to candidates on their personal email IDs, send them a LinkedIn connection request as well as send them a LinkedIn InMail with personalized messaging. They can manage candidate responses within the dashboard and visualize the talent pipeline at multiple levels on the basis of their evaluation of the candidates. Riverbed Launches Aternity Sentiment to Deliver the Most Comprehensive Digital Employee Experience (DEX) Solution

Businesswire | May 19, 2023

Riverbed, the leader in unified observability, today announced the launch of Aternity Sentiment. The addition of Sentiment to Alluvio Aternity™ optimizes the digital experience by correlating employee sentiment to application and device performance, enabling organizations to pinpoint user experience issues and take prescriptive, targeted actions that increase productivity and employee satisfaction, service quality and business performance. Understanding outcomes of critical IT projects on the overall digital experience requires receiving timely feedback from the actual user perspective. To effectively gauge user satisfaction, and increase response rates to capture the workplace digital employee experience (DEX), Aternity Sentiment enables organizations to deploy customizable surveys to targeted user groups across multiple devices and locations. Aternity Sentiment captures feedback through flexible survey components, including Net Promoter Score® (NPS)1, an industry standard scale for measuring customer satisfaction, to provide organizations with an enhanced view of user engagement and productivity, resulting in improved business performance. By tightly correlating objective and subject metrics through Sentiment, the Alluvio Aternity DEM (digital experience management) solution provides the full picture of the digital experience, including, nuanced remediation feedback and additional human context. PrimePay Unveils New Payroll-Connected On-Demand Pay

PRnewswire | March 24, 2023

PrimePay, LLC., a national human capital management (HCM) technology leader, today announced the launch of its Payroll-Connected On-Demand Pay in partnership with Clair, an embedded financial wellness solution that helps employees cover expenses in the moment. Clair is connected to PrimePay's payroll and HR technology, streamlining earned wage advance loans without disrupting working capital or payroll administration. According to SCORE, a Small Business Administration resource partner, employment challenges have overtaken financing and acquiring customers as the number one challenge keeping business owners up at night. In a recent study by Ernst & Young*, nearly 60% of employees would view a prospective employer more favorably if on-demand pay was part of a new job offer. Flexible on-demand pay is a fast-growing job perk that employers can offer prospective and current employees at no cost. "Whether it's medical bills, car repairs, or an extra credit card payment, our employees now have access to their money when they need it, if they need it," said Chief Performance Officer Patrick O'Hara at EverView, a PrimePay client. In the first 45 days of EverView's usage of the offering, the adoption rate exceeded 10%.
